Red Alder and Bael Pruning

Pruning is an important part of Red Alder and Bael care. Pruning helps to grow the plant with a faster rate. Red Alder and Bael pruning is done as follows:

  • Red Alder pruning: Remove damaged leaves, Remove dead branches and Remove dead leaves

  • Bael pruning: Cut upper 1/3 section when young to enhancegrowth and Remove dead branches

Plants need fertilizers for its growth and increasing the life. Red Alder and Bael fertilizers are as follows:

  • Red Alder fertilizers: All-Purpose Liquid Fertilizer and Nitrogen
  • Bael fertilizers: General purpose fertilizer with an NPK ratio 3-1-2
